Subscription History thru API

Hi All,

I'm trying to get the subscription history of report builder on our report server.
I saw that there was a "SubscriptionHistory" model on the swagger https://app.swaggerhub.com/apis/microsoft-rs/PBIRS/2.0#/SubscriptionHistory .

TheBanker_0-1705422549212.png
However, I don't know how to use it ☹️
I tried to do a get like this:
"https://mycorporatesite.com/SSRSReports/api/v2.0/SubscriptionHistory?SubscriptionID=33b5b19f-9965-47..."
but it didn't work 😞.
Can you help me please ?

NB: I am not a server administrator, so I cannot request job tasks

Hi @TheBanker ,

The SubscriptionHistory API requires the ID parameter, as well as the type parameter, the start and end times of the subscription, and the status and content of the subscription.

This can only be run by a member with the admin role.

Below is the official link will help you:

Develop with the REST APIs for Power BI Report Server - Power BI | Microsoft Learn
